What is Double Glazing?
Double glazing describes a window building method that utilizes two layers of glass separated by an area filled with air or gas. This style supplies enhanced insulation compared to single glazing, making homes more energy-efficient and comfy.

The cost of double glazing can vary substantially based on a number of elements:
1. Window Type
Different window designs can influence the cost. Common types include:
Casement WindowsSash WindowsTilt and Turn WindowsBay and Bow Windows
Table 1: Average Cost of Different Window Types
Window TypeTypical Price (per window)Casement Windows₤ 300 - ₤ 600Sash Windows₤ 600 - ₤ 1,200Tilt and Turn₤ 400 - ₤ 800Bay and Bow₤ 800 - ₤ 1,5002. Glass Specifications

3. Frame Material
The framing material impacts both aesthetics and expense. Typical products include:
uPVC: Often the most budget friendly.Aluminium: More costly however durable and trendy.Wood: Offers traditional appeal but typically at a higher rate point.
Table 2: Average Cost of Frame Materials
Frame MaterialTypical Price (per window)uPVC₤ 150 - ₤ 400Aluminium₤ 300 - ₤ 800Lumber₤ 400 - ₤ 1,0004. Setup Costs

Prices can vary substantially across different regions due to require, the cost of labor, and other regional economic factors. Urban locations typically experience higher prices than rural areas.
General Price Ranges
Usually, homeowners can expect to pay in between ₤ 400 to ₤ 1,200 per window installed, depending on the factors discussed above. Bigger properties needing numerous installations can benefit from bulk discount rates from suppliers.
